If you’re thinking about going camping for the first time, you may need to invest in some gear to make the experience as comfortable as possible. Aside from renting a tent or RV, here are some camping supplies to add to your list.

What Camping Supplies Do I Need?

1. Kitchen Utensils

Throughout your trip, you’ll need dishes and utensils to eat and drink from around the campsite. Purchase items like plates, bowls, cups, and flatware. If you’re using an RV with a sink, opt for washable items, but disposable products may be preferred for those using tents.

2. Fire Pit

Enjoying an evening fire at the campsite can be a fun bonding experience. It can also be a practical way to roast marshmallows and heat up meals. Some sites offer fire pits, but others may be harder to come by. Purchase your own that’s easy to set up so you don’t need to worry about whether one is available.

3. Portable Lights

Portable lights can make it easier to get around at night, improve safety, and add to the aesthetics of your campsite. You can find string lights to put up around your camper, spotlights to illuminate a specific spot, or lights that you can carry with you on hikes or outings.

4. Cooking Gear

camping suppliesIf you want to prepare your own meals around the campfire, purchase a few items to help you heat items easily. For example, you can get grillers for burgers, iron casts for sandwiches, and skewers for marshmallows.

5. Clothes Lines

You may also need to wash clothes or bedding at your campsite. After you clean off items in a tub or body of water, you can easily hang them from your camper or across posts on your campsite using a clothesline. This may also be useful for drying swimsuits or other items if you plan on going in the water.
